Stroke Recovery Program with Modified Cardiac Rehabilitation Improves Mortality, Functional & Cardiovascular
Sara J Cuccurullo1, Talya K Fleming1, Stavros Zinonos2
1JFK Johnson Rehabilitation Institute at Hackensack Meridian Health, 65 James Street, Edison, NJ 08820, United States.
A stroke recovery program (SRP) with modified cardiac rehabilitation significantly reduced mortality and improved function and cardiovascular performance in stroke survivors. This comprehensive approach enhances recovery and secondary prevention post-stroke.

Background:
- Physical activity and exercise are crucial for stroke recovery and secondary prevention.
- A stroke recovery program (SRP) integrating modified cardiac rehabilitation was investigated.
Purpose of the Study:
- To evaluate the impact of an SRP with modified cardiac rehabilitation on mortality and functional outcomes in stroke survivors.
- To assess the association between SRP participation and post-stroke survival and performance.
Main Methods:
- Retrospective analysis of 449 acute stroke survivors (2015-2020).
- Comparison of 246 SRP participants versus 203 non-participants over 1 year post-stroke.
- Statistical analysis included log-rank test, Cox proportional hazard, and linear mixed-effects models.
Main Results:
- SRP participants showed a four-fold reduction in 1-year all-cause mortality (P=0.005).
- Statistically significant improvements in all Activity Measure of Post-Acute Care domains (P<0.001).
- Cardiovascular performance increased by 78% over 36 sessions (P<0.001).
Conclusions:
- A comprehensive SRP with modified cardiac rehabilitation decreases mortality in stroke survivors.
- This program significantly improves overall function and cardiovascular performance.
- The findings support the integration of cardiac rehabilitation into stroke recovery programs.
